Job Description
The Newport-Mesa Unified School District, located in the vibrant cities of Newport Beach and Costa Mesa, California, is committed to providing high-quality educational services and a supportive working environment for its staff. Serving a diverse student population, the district emphasizes the wellbeing of its students, including their nutritional needs through its dedicated Nutrition Services department. The district's Nutrition Services department is responsible for preparing and serving nutritious meals to students and staff at various school sites and the Central Kitchen. Job Duties
- Assist in the preparation, cooking, baking and service of food
- prepare breads, dressings, vegetables and assemble various ingredients as assigned
- package, wrap and reheat food items according to established procedures and portion control standards
- Heat, fry, portion and serve food to students and staff according to established procedures
- Prepare salads and sandwiches
- open cans
- set up faculty and staff salad bar
- replenish containers as necessary
- Clean serving counters, tables, food containers, and other nutrition service equipment
- prepare food and beverages for sale
- count and set-up plates, trays and utensils
- arrange serving areas
- Sweep and mop floors to assure a safe and sanitary work environment
- Operate dishwashers and wash trays, pots, pans, plates, utensils, and other serving equipment
- Stock condiments, food items and paper goods
- assist in storage and rotation of supplies
- assist with periodic inventories as assigned
- Perform routine cashiering duties
- count money and make correct change
- prepare notifications on status of prepaid lunch accounts
- account for transactions using assigned software
- lock and unlock serving areas as required
- Set up speed lines and carts for food service
- Operate nutrition service equipment including slicer, mixer, oven, steamer and grill
- Plan and estimate ordering quantities for food and supplies
- assist in ordering, receiving, storing, rotation and inventory of food and supplies
- load and unload food service containers from delivery vehicles
- Assist in setting up special events and catering affairs
- Assist in supervision of student behavior
- Perform related duties as assigned
